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73608373279 86 93
32717030064 3125
32717030064 3125
307 7676926 68
All about undefined
Interested in learning more?
32717030064 3125
307 7676926 68
See more
201 8237
64356755037 90 93 27780206 155
See more
79606 26434276 1560
909 5903 92
See more